+The Basic Objective: The Core Mechanics
+
Unlike Texas Hold'em, you do not make any playing decisions during the actual hand. The casino staff runs the math. Your only job is to predict which set of cards will have a value nearest to 9. You can only wager on three outcomes: the Player side, the Banker side, or a dead draw. You must remember that these names do not represent you and the casino; they are simply the names for the two sets of cards.
+Calculating Hand Values and Baccarat Scoring
+
How you calculate points in this game is slightly unusual. All standard number cards are worth their face value. Aces are always worth exactly 1 point. But all face cards and tens are worth absolutely zero. The strange part is that a hand's total cannot go over 9. If the cards add up to a double-digit number, you simply drop the first digit. For example, if the cards are an eight and a seven, the total is 15. By dropping the 1, the hand is worth 5.

+The 'Banker' bet is statistically the best wager because the drawing rules slightly favor that hand.
+Due to its statistical advantage, the casino charges a standard 5% commission on winning Banker wagers.
+Never, under any circumstances, bet on the Tie. The casino edge is huge of around 14 percent.
+Do not worry about the draw mechanics; the dealer does the math for you.

+Comparing Baccarat Bets
+
To ensure you play perfectly, we have constructed a simple table that breaks down the exact math for every possible wager.
+
+Bet TypeOdds PaidCasino Advantage
+Banker1 to 1 (Minus 5% Commission)Best Option (1.06%)
+PlayerExactly 1:11.24% (A very solid choice)
+The Tie Bet8:114.36% (A terrible mathematically choice)
